Transaction e08094d2870badf1a93107590301b5435c31b421f9d214e9164650187108b878
1 Input
2 Outputs
- e08094d2870badf1a93107590301b5435c31b421f9d214e9164650187108b878:0
- e08094d2870badf1a93107590301b5435c31b421f9d214e9164650187108b878:1
value 67237
address 17E37pP1N6xzXTA8ayHkgzri4cHdCAT9vu
value 670165571
address 1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X